Event description
EMPLOYEE IS BURNED WHEN SPILLED FUEL IS IGNITED
Investigation abstract
Employee #1 was in the process of transferring gas on a fuel truck from the rear backfired igniting the fuel which engulfed the forecourt. Employee #1's mother then threw the emergency shut off switch for the fuel pumps at the station. Empl oyee #1 and the volunteer firefighter were hospitalized for burns and scalds, an d Employee #1 mother suffered non hospitalized burns and scalding. tank to the front tank of a bus by pumping fuel by a hose line from a reel atta ched to the rear of the fuel truck. It was believed that the contents of the rea r tank of the fuel truck would fit into the front tank of the bus. Employee #1 t hen went into the service station to answer a ringing phone and when he returned he noticed gasoline spilling out of the bus tank across the forecourt of the se rvice station. A volunteer firefighter was at the location and seeing the spill, went to the truck, and turned off the pump, and at the same time, Employee #1 w as about to shut off the hose reel. In the process of shutting the pump down, it
